Помощь по скриптам | мелкая помошь
Ребят подскажите как подключить базу данных к сайту вот в этом коде?
<?
// авторизация на сервере базы
if(!($db=@mysql_connect($set['mysql_host'], $set['mysql_user'],$set['mysql_pass'])))
{
//echo $set['mysql_host'], $set['mysql_user'],$set['mysql_pass'];
echo "Нет соединения с сервером базы<br />*проверьте параметры подключения";
exit;
}
// подключение к базе
if (!@mysql_select_db($set['mysql_db_name'],$db))
{
echo "База даных не найдена<br />*проверьте, существует ли данная база";
exit;
}
mysql_query('set charset utf8',$db);
mysql_query('SET names utf8',$db);
mysql_query('set character_set_client="utf8"',$db);
mysql_query('set character_set_connection="utf8"',$db);
mysql_query('set character_set_result="utf8"',$db);
// оптимизация всех таблиц
function db_optimize(){
time_limit(20);// Ставим ограничение на 20 секунд
$tab=mysql_query('SHOW TABLES');
while ($tables=mysql_fetch_array($tab)){
mysql_query("OPTIMIZE TABLE `$tables[0]`");}}
?>
поставлю плюс в акк
________
посл. ред. 26.08.2015 в 11:21; всего 1 раз(а); by bypass
<?
// авторизация на сервере базы
if(!($db=@mysql_connect($set['mysql_host'], $set['mysql_user'],$set['mysql_pass'])))
{
//echo $set['mysql_host'], $set['mysql_user'],$set['mysql_pass'];
echo "Нет соединения с сервером базы<br />*проверьте параметры подключения";
exit;
}
// подключение к базе
if (!@mysql_select_db($set['mysql_db_name'],$db))
{
echo "База даных не найдена<br />*проверьте, существует ли данная база";
exit;
}
mysql_query('set charset utf8',$db);
mysql_query('SET names utf8',$db);
mysql_query('set character_set_client="utf8"',$db);
mysql_query('set character_set_connection="utf8"',$db);
mysql_query('set character_set_result="utf8"',$db);
// оптимизация всех таблиц
function db_optimize(){
time_limit(20);// Ставим ограничение на 20 секунд
$tab=mysql_query('SHOW TABLES');
while ($tables=mysql_fetch_array($tab)){
mysql_query("OPTIMIZE TABLE `$tables[0]`");}}
?>
поставлю плюс в акк
________
посл. ред. 26.08.2015 в 11:21; всего 1 раз(а); by bypass
Это не в этом файле подключать надо
Данные для бд в другом файле должны быть
Хотя можно так)
<?
$set['mysql_host']='localhost';
$set['mysql_user']='имя пользователя';
$set['mysql_pass']='пароль бд';
$set['mysql_db_name']='имя бд';
// авторизация на сервере базы
if(!($db=@mysql_connect($set['mysql_host'], $set['mysql_user'],$set['mysql_pass'])))
{
//echo $set['mysql_host'], $set['mysql_user'],$set['mysql_pass'];
echo "Нет соединения с сервером базы<br />*проверьте параметры подключения";
exit;
}
// подключение к базе
if (!@mysql_select_db($set['mysql_db_name'],$db))
{
echo "База даных не найдена<br />*проверьте, существует ли данная база";
exit;
}
mysql_query('set charset utf8',$db);
mysql_query('SET names utf8',$db);
mysql_query('set character_set_client="utf8"',$db);
mysql_query('set character_set_connection="utf8"',$db);
mysql_query('set character_set_result="utf8"',$db);
// оптимизация всех таблиц
function db_optimize(){
time_limit(20);// Ставим ограничение на 20 секунд
$tab=mysql_query('SHOW TABLES');
while ($tables=mysql_fetch_array($tab)){
mysql_query("OPTIMIZE TABLE `$tables[0]`");}}
?>
[J]iK (26.08.2015 в 11:05)
Это не в этом файле подключать надо
Это не в этом файле подключать надо
в этом потому что в setting_6.2.dat не идет
193830347 (26.08.2015 в 11:08)
[J]iK (26.08.2015 в 11:05)
Это не в этом файле подключать надо
в этом потому что в setting_6.2.dat не идет
[J]iK (26.08.2015 в 11:05)
Это не в этом файле подключать надо
в этом потому что в setting_6.2.dat не идет
Без бе, но руки ровнять надо и все пойдет
193830347 (26.08.2015 в 11:08)
[J]iK (26.08.2015 в 11:05)
Это не в этом файле подключать надо
в этом потому что в setting_6.2.dat не идет
[J]iK (26.08.2015 в 11:05)
Это не в этом файле подключать надо
в этом потому что в setting_6.2.dat не идет
Руки равняй)